    3. After exercise training summary the polar move displays an exercise summary after each exercise session: duration the duration of your exercise session. In zone the time you have spent in the target zone during your exercise session. Average your average heart rate during the exercise session. Ma...

    Precautions • polar move heart rate monitor is designed to indicate the level of physiological strain and recovery during and after exercise session. No other use is intended or implied. • medical devices in professional use sets high standards for the manufacturer, distributor and user of a medical...
